description

We will fill the different vessels with water to the same level, and check the amount of stress (weight) loaded on the bottom of the vessel.

Although the volume of water, at the same level level, is different for each vessel, the stress is the same.

Since the surface area of the bottom of the vessel does not change, it turns out that thepressure on the bottom of the vessel, in each case, is equal, regardless of the mass of water in the vessel.

From this we can conclude that the hydrostatic pressure at the bottom of a vessel, filled with a certain liquid, is generated only depending on the height of the water column above the bottom.
